BANGKOK (FIBA U19 World Championship for Women) - Korea staved off a second quarter rally to down hosts Thailand 66-55 in a 13-16 classification round game on Monday.
Korea, now will take on African champions Mali for the 13th place. Thailand will play Tunisia in an effort to avoid the wooden spoon.
Suwimon Sangtad, the highest scorer for Thailand with 15 points, scored eight of them in the second quarter as the hosts fought back to level the scores 31-all going into the changing rooms. Thailand outscored Korea 22-15 in during this time.
But Korean centre Lee Jeonghyun, who had scored nine points in the first half, added nine more in the third quarter to put her team back on track.
Korea had no trouble after that.
Lee went on to top-score the game with 21 points. Ahn Hyojin converted four of her eight three-pointer attempts to record 14 points.
